What is website maintenance?

Website maintenance is the ongoing technical work used to keep a live website secure, compatible, recoverable and functioning as intended. It can include software updates, backups, monitoring, bug fixes, performance checks, content changes and technical support.

Controlled updates

Website updates should be managed, not simply clicked

The right process depends on the site, but important changes should have a clear path from preparation to recovery.

1

Review

Understand the change, dependencies and potential impact.

2

Prepare

Confirm backups, access and a suitable recovery route.

3

Test

Use staging or controlled testing where the change warrants it.

4

Deploy

Apply the agreed update or technical change.

5

Check

Verify the affected pages, forms, integrations and customer journey.

H

Website Hosting

Hosting provides the infrastructure that serves your website to visitors. It does not automatically include ongoing development, updates or technical support.

M

Website Maintenance

Maintenance covers the ongoing technical work needed to keep the website updated, supported, recoverable and functioning as intended.

Website Maintenance in Practice

ToughCAD: separating content and commerce for a more reliable ordering experience

ToughCAD's public-facing website remains on WordPress, while its online ordering workflow was moved to a dedicated eCommerce application. The previous setup placed more of the commerce experience inside WordPress, including file-upload and print-order tasks. As the workflow became more demanding, performance and reliability became more important.

Rather than replacing the entire site, the architecture was split around the job each system needed to do.

How are website updates handled safely?

Important updates should have an appropriate recovery path. Depending on the website, that can include backups, staging or controlled testing, deployment checks and rollback planning.
